Alarm indications

Alarm indications are displayed under the following circumstances. The warning messages are shown
blinking.
• When remaining battery power or remaining tape is low .
• Improper operation attempted.
• Abnormality generated in the GY-DV300.
Warning Indication
TAPE NEAR END
TAPE END
TAPE BEGIN
LOW VOLTAGE
CLOSE CASSETTE COVER!
NO TAPE
REC INHIBIT
1394 INHIBIT
COPY INHIBIT
COPY GUARD
CASSETTE COVER OPEND!
CASS.CARRIAGE UNLOCK
VTR WARNING [DEW]
HEAD CLEANING
REQUIRED!
VTR WARNING (HARD)
VTR WARNING (TAPE)

Displayed when the remaining tape is 3 minutes or less in the shooting
mode. It is not shown in the playback mode.
Displayed when the tape has run out.
Displayed when the tape is at the beginning position.
Displayed when remaining battery power becomes low .
Displayed when operation is attempted while the cassette cover is open.
Displayed when no videocassette is inserted and the VTR trigger button
is pressed.
Displayed when an unrecordable videocassette (the switch on the back
of the cassette is set to "SAVE") is loaded.
Displayed if an attempt to record is made when no DV signal is input.
Displayed when attempt to record a copy-guard protected signal is made.
Displayed when an attempt is made to playback a copy-guarded tape.
Displayed when the cassette cover was opened during recording.
Displayed when the cassette cover is closed but the cassette holder is
not locked.
Displayed when condensation occurs in the unit.
Displayed in case of video head clogging.
Lights when abnormality occurs in the unit.
Displayed when the tape is cut.
